Posted by David Damage on Saturday, April 30, 2011 In : News
Chris
Sabin injured his knee during a match against Anarquia that aired on
last night's TNA iMPACT! when he attempted a springboard clothesline and
tweaked his knee due to Anarchia being out of position to receive the
move. The referee was instructed to end the bout when it appeared Sabin
was injured. Anarchia performed a small package to end the match. Continue reading...

Posted by David Damage on Saturday, April 30, 2011 In : News
Variety
is reporting that WrestleMania 27, which featured the return of The
Rock, along with appearances by Steve Austin, Trish Stratus and Snooki
from Jersey Shore, scored one million PPV buys. Final numbers are not
available, but word is that buys are up 30% in North America and up 15%
overseas. For comparison, WrestleMania 25 scored 960,000 buys, and WrestleMania 26 did 885,000 buys.

Posted by David Damage on Wednesday, April 27, 2011 In : News
AAA wrestler Charly Manson has been charged with attacking three police
officers, aggravated assault and attacking authority figures. He was
remanded without bail and faces up to fifteen years in prison. One of
the officers he attacked is still hospitalized with a fractured skull
while the other needs nose surgery and work done on his neck. Continue reading...
